Job Description

Overview: 

The ideal candidate will be responsible for analyzing business problems to implement and improve computer systems. You will analyze user requirements, procedures, and problems to automate or enhance existing systems and review computer system capabilities, workflow, and scheduling limitations. You may also analyze or recommend commercially available software.

Responsibilities:

  • System Design and Architecture: Lead Support the design,  and architecture, and integration of computer systems, including hardware, software, networking, and storage components. Develop comprehensive system blueprints and specifications to guide implementation efforts. 

  • Technology Evaluation and Selection: Evaluate emerging technologies, tools, and platforms to determine their suitability for inclusion in system designs. Make informed recommendations based on performance, scalability, reliability, and cost considerations. 

  • Performance Optimization: Identify performance bottlenecks and inefficiencies in existing computer systems and propose innovative solutions to optimize performance, throughput, and resource utilization. 

  • Security and Compliance: Collaborate with cybersecurity experts to integrate robust security measures into system designs and architectures. Comprehensive understanding of regulatory compliance standards relevant to the IT industry to eEnsure compliance with relevant regulations and industry standards, such as the Federal Information Security Management Act (FISMA), National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) frameworks, and General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) for international considerations. 

  • Scalability and Resilience: Design systems that can seamlessly scale to accommodate growing workloads and user demands. Implement redundancy and failover mechanisms to enhance system resilience and availability. 

  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work closely with software developers, network engineers, database administrators, and other stakeholders to integrate system components and ensure seamless interoperability. 

  • Documentation and Reporting: Create detailed technical documentation, including system design documents, architecture diagrams, and implementation guides. Provide regular progress updates and reports to project stakeholders. 

  • Continuous Improvement: Stay abreast of industry trends, advancements, and best practices in computer systems engineering and architecture. Proactively identify opportunities for process improvement and optimization.

What you need to know about the Bengaluru Tech Scene

Dubbed the "Silicon Valley of India," Bengaluru has emerged as the nation's leading hub for information technology and a go-to destination for startups. Home to tech giants like ISRO, Infosys, Wipro and HAL, the city attracts and cultivates a rich pool of tech talent, supported by numerous educational and research institutions including the Indian Institute of Science, Bangalore Institute of Technology, and the International Institute of Information Technology.
